The Doors
The Sixties - a time when drugs and music set the stage for a pop
revolution. When poet, singer, and songwriter Jim Morrison
meets up with keyboardist Ray Manzarek, they had no idea they
would form one of the most enduring, legendary bands in
American history. Add guitarist Robbie Krieger, drummer John
Densemore, a little bit of acid, and a whole lot of booze, The
Doors were poised to take the L.A. music scene, and all of
America by storm! The turbulent Sixties were matched by the
Doors' extended rock anthems, as well as Morrison's legendary
substance abuse, including an arrest in Hartford for Indecent
Exposure. Unfortunately, Jim's untimely death in 1971 at the
too-young age of 27 put an end to what was one of the most
influential band careers to ever hit the American rock culture.
